This software is not recommended, though for retailers and online sellers because with that you also need to track your sales taxes, which you cannot do here. ...Internet bills, phone bills, stationary and office supplies. You can claim business related telephone, mobile, and broadband costs as self-employed allowable expenses, as well as equipment costs such as stationary, postage, printing, computer software, computer hardware, and ink cartridges for printing. Follow the steps to upgrade.Go to the Transactions menu. On Android, select the menu ☰ icon and then Transactions. Find and select the transaction you want to split. Select Edit. Select the Split option. In the Category column, select Personal or a business category for each split. In the Amount column, enter the amount for each split. To add additional splits, select ... Your personal allowance is the amount of income you can earn as a self-employed or sole trader before you start losing a portion of your tax-free allowance. Here’s how it works. The personal tax allowance for 2023/34 is £12,570, and this is fixed until 2025/26. This means that if you’re self-employed or a sole trader ... QuickBooks Self-Employed Login. Your Self Assessment filing details with QuickBooks will then pop up., When you’re an employee, you pay 7.65% in Social Security and Medicare tax, and your employer pays the other 7.65%. When you’re self-employed, you pay the full 15.3%, in what is known as “self-employment tax.”. Only the first $128,400 of self-employment income is eligible for taxation at the full 15.3% tax rate.
